Summary: "Each display topic includes a comprehensive background discussion along with detailed assembly instructions, an explanation of the genesis of the idea and suggestions on ways to adapt these designs to fit larger spaces. The author includes everyday items, prized collectibles and authentic antiques in each of the 45 displays featured"--Provided by publisher.
